Bacillus velezensis FZB42, the model strain for Gram-positive plant-growth-promoting and biocontrol rhizobacteria, has been isolated in 1998 and sequenced in 2007. In order to celebrate these anniversaries, we summarize here the recent knowledge about FZB42. In last 20 years, more than 140 articles devoted to FZB42 have been published. Description and significance. Bacillus velezensis JW has a broad antimicrobial activity against fish pathogenic bacteria.. Dietary administration of Bacillus velezensis JW induces immune response in fish.. Dietary administration of Bacillus velezensis JW enhances disease resistance against A. hydrophila.. Genome analysis of Bacillus velezensis JW revealed a large number of gene clusters involved in antimicrobial …
